摘要:在一个高效的App开发团队中,分工明确且协同合作是关键。开发团队通常分为不同角色,如产品经理、设计师、前端开发者、后端开发者、测试工程师等。团队成员各司其职,如产品经理负责产品设计需求,设计师负责UI设计,开发者则负责前后端实现。高效的沟通、定期会议以及使用版本控制工具等有助于团队协作。各成员间紧密配合,确保项目按时高质量完成。团队协作模式注重协同合作,共同推进项目进展。
本文目录导读:
随着移动互联网的飞速发展,App开发已成为炙手可热的行业,一个成功的App离不开团队的努力,而分工的合理性则是项目成功的关键,本文将探讨App开发过程中的分工模式,以期为团队管理者和开发者提供有益的参考。
App开发团队的主要角色
1、项目经理
项目经理是团队的核心,负责整个项目的协调和管理,他们需要具备良好的组织能力和沟通技巧,以确保团队成员之间的顺畅沟通,项目经理需把握项目进度,协调资源,管理风险,以及与客户沟通需求。
2、设计师
设计师包括UI设计师和UX设计师,UI设计师负责软件界面的视觉设计,而UX设计师则关注用户体验,确保用户在使用App时能够享受到便捷、流畅的体验,设计师需要与开发人员紧密合作,确保设计方案的实现。
3、开发人员
开发人员是App开发的主力军,包括前端开发人员、后端开发人员和测试人员,前端开发人员负责App界面的开发,后端开发人员则负责数据库和服务器端的开发,测试人员负责在开发过程中进行功能测试、性能测试和兼容性测试,以确保App的质量和稳定性。
App开发中的分工模式
1、功能性分工
根据App的功能模块进行分工,如社交、电商、新闻等模块,每个模块由一个或多个开发人员负责,确保各模块的开发进度和质量,这种分工模式有助于明确责任,提高开发效率。
2、阶段性分工
在App开发的不同阶段,如需求分析、设计、开发、测试等阶段,分配不同的任务给团队成员,这种分工模式有助于确保每个阶段的工作质量,提高项目的整体进度。
3、技能性分工
根据团队成员的技能和专长进行分工,前端高手负责前端开发工作,后端专家负责后端开发,测试人员专注于测试工作,这种分工模式有助于发挥团队成员的优势,提高工作质量。
分工过程中的注意事项
1、沟通与合作
在分工过程中,团队成员之间需要保持良好的沟通和合作,项目经理应定期组织团队会议,了解各成员的工作进度和遇到的问题,协调资源解决问题,设计师和开发人员之间也需要紧密合作,确保设计方案的实现。
2、明确职责与权限
在分工过程中,应明确各成员的职责和权限,项目经理需制定详细的项目计划,明确各阶段的任务和目标,团队成员应清楚自己的工作内容和职责范围,以便更好地完成工作任务。
3、灵活调整分工
在实际开发过程中,可能会遇到各种不可预测的问题,团队应根据实际情况灵活调整分工,以确保项目的顺利进行,当某个模块的开发难度较大时,可以增派开发人员协助完成;当项目进度紧张时,可以调整阶段性分工,优先完成关键功能。
App开发的分工是一个复杂而关键的过程,需要团队之间的协同合作,通过功能性分工、阶段性分工和技能性分工等模式,可以确保项目的顺利进行,在分工过程中,团队应注重沟通与合作、明确职责与权限,并根据实际情况灵活调整分工,只有这样,才能打造一个高效、和谐的App开发团队,共同推动项目的成功。

